Savor the rich flavors of Hanith, a traditional Middle Eastern lamb dish infused with aromatic spices and served over fluffy basmati rice. Ideal for a cozy family dinner or a festive gathering with friends.

Ingredients

  • 1 kg lamb, cut into chunks
  • 2 tablespoons olive oil
  • 1 tablespoon ground cumin
  • 1 tablespoon ground coriander
  • 1 teaspoon ground turmeric
  • 1 teaspoon salt
  • 4 cups water
  • 2 cups basmati rice

Method

  1. 1

    In a large bowl, combine the lamb chunks with olive oil, cumin, coriander, turmeric, and salt. Mix well to coat the meat evenly. Let it marinate for at least 1 hour, preferably overnight in the refrigerator.

  2. 2

    In a large pot, add the marinated lamb and pour in the water. Bring to a boil over medium heat, then reduce to low heat and cover. Let it simmer for about 90 minutes or until the lamb is tender.

  3. 3

    Once the lamb is cooked, remove it from the pot and set aside. Strain the broth and reserve it for cooking the rice.

  4. 4

    In the same pot, add the strained broth back and bring it to a boil. Add the soaked basmati rice and cook according to package instructions until the rice is fluffy and fully absorbed the liquid.

  5. 5

    Once the rice is cooked, fluff it with a fork. Serve the rice on a large platter, topped with the tender lamb pieces.

  6. 6

    Garnish with fresh herbs like parsley or cilantro if desired, and serve hot.
